### Exactly what are SEER and EER Scores?

**SEER (Seasonal Strength Effectiveness Ratio)** measures the cooling efficiency of the air conditioner or warmth pump above a complete cooling season. It truly is calculated by dividing the cooling output (in British Thermal Models or BTUs) by the whole Vitality input (in watt-several hours) all through that period of time. In essence, SEER steps the common Vitality effectiveness of the unit throughout different temperatures and disorders in excess of the training course of a year.

**EER (Strength Efficiency Ratio)**, on the other hand, steps the cooling effectiveness of an HVAC system at a selected temperature, generally 95°F. It is actually calculated equally by dividing the cooling output (BTUs) with the Electrical power enter (watt-several hours), but it surely signifies a snapshot in the method's general performance underneath standardized problems rather than above an entire year.

### Crucial Discrepancies Amongst SEER and EER Ratings

1. **Seasonal vs. Snapshot**: SEER offers a seasonal common of Power effectiveness, looking at fluctuating temperatures and load variations. EER presents a set measure of effectiveness at a selected temperature, ordinarily through peak cooling conditions.

2. **Temperature Sensitivity**: SEER accounts for changes in temperature, making it a far better indicator for locations with assorted climates. EER is a lot more beneficial in consistently scorching climates, the place peak efficiency underneath superior temperatures is significant.

3. **Performance Measurement**: SEER usually has increased numerical values than EER mainly because it measures efficiency more than a broader range of situations. EER is usually used for business systems in which peak performance below unique ailments is a lot more crucial than seasonal averages.

### Why Do SEER and EER Rankings Subject?

Knowledge SEER and EER ratings is important for analyzing the effectiveness of HVAC systems. A better SEER or EER score implies the procedure uses fewer Vitality to offer precisely the same standard of cooling, which translates to decrease Electricity costs and decreased environmental impression.

one. **Strength Savings**: Upgrading to the process with a better SEER or EER score may lead to considerable Strength cost savings as time passes. Such as, changing an aged air conditioner by using a SEER ranking of ten that has a new device rated at sixteen SEER may end up in Power savings of as many as 38%.

2. **Environmental Impression**: More Vitality-successful HVAC units reduce the need for electric power, which subsequently decreases greenhouse fuel emissions related to energy era. By deciding on units with increased SEER and EER rankings, you happen to be contributing to a far more sustainable foreseeable future.

3. **Consolation and Overall performance**: Techniques with greater SEER and EER ratings often have State-of-the-art functions for instance variable-velocity compressors and fans, which increase comfort and ease by protecting much more steady indoor temperatures and humidity degrees.

### How to Choose the Right SEER and EER Scores for Your requirements

When picking an HVAC method, It is really vital to harmony upfront expenditures with very long-expression Strength price savings. While higher SEER and EER scores ordinarily point out superior Strength effectiveness, they also often include a greater cost tag. Here are a few things to consider when picking out the ideal system:

1. **Local weather**: In places with reasonable climates, a high SEER rating may not supply considerable extra cost savings when compared with a moderately-rated energy efficiency in hvac terms unit. Having said that, in areas with Severe temperatures, investing in a superior SEER or EER system may lead to considerable Electrical power discounts.

2. **Usage Styles**: Should you use your HVAC procedure intensely throughout the year, the next SEER ranking can provide more extensive-expression financial savings. However, If the utilization is more occasional, a process using a lower SEER ranking could be ample for your requirements.

3. **Finances**: Although higher-rated devices offer you more Electricity cost savings, they often appear at a top quality. Think about your finances as well as the envisioned payback period of time when choosing on the right technique.
